There are two methods to draught proof the sash window: self-adhesive weatherstrips and brush seals. While the self-adhesive version is the most commonly used but it's not always the ideal solution.

Draught-proofing windows for sash windows is feasible with the use of pile strips or brush seals. They are usually sold in two parts. The top sash will be one piece and the bottom the other. When the sash is closed and the brush seal is press-fit into the gap creating an effective barrier.

The brush seal is often installed before installing the draught excluder. It is more durable and effective method to secure sash window frames from drafts. However, it is important to know that this is not an ideal solution for larger windows with sash gaps.

Gapseal's spongy seal is a different option. This non-permanent window sealer is made of a special material that can be easily reinstalled. After applying the sealer, it expands to fill the gaps. Gapseal is designed to fill gaps between 2 and 9 millimeters. It can be used at the beginning of the cold season, and then removed in spring.
